Mahmudul Hasan

Consultant, ICSETEP(UGC, ADB, DU) | Research Fellow, Ministry of ICT

I am currently pursuing my M.Sc. in Computer Science and Engineering at the University of Dhaka and working as a Consultant in the ICSETEP Sub-project (UGC), University of Dhaka, contributing to AI-driven enterprise business intelligence systems. I am also actively involved in research at the Cognitive Agents & Interaction Lab (CAIL), University of Dhaka.

My research interests include Artificial Intelligence, Deep Learning, and Natural Language Processing, focusing on low-resource language technologies, advanced OCR systems, and AI-powered educational technologies.

I aspire to pursue a PhD and build a career in academia as a teacher, researcher, and mentor, contributing to impactful AI research and helping develop the next generation of scientists and engineers.

View CV Contact Me
Mahmudul Hasan

Publications & Presentations

Accepted

Md. Mahmudul Hasan, Ahmed Nesar Tahsin Choudhury, Mahmudul Hasan, and Md Mosaddek Khan
EMNLP 2025 Conference on Empirical Methods in Natural Language Processing

Developed a resource-efficient HTR system for Bengali script using grapheme-based tokenization and decoder-only transformers, achieving ~95% character-level accuracy.

Preprints

Istiaq Ahmed Fahad, Abdullah Ibne Hanif Arean, Nazmus Sakib Ahmed, Mahmudul Hasan
arXiv arXiv:2502.17843, 2025

Applied transformer-based DETR model for robust vehicle detection in challenging road conditions, addressing safety concerns in transportation.

Google Scholar: View full publication list  ·  ORCID: 0009-0009-3125-1340

Research & Professional Experience

March 2026 – Present
Consultant
ICSETEP Sub-project (UGC), University of Dhaka

Contributing to an ADB-funded project on enterprise AI systems and data-driven business intelligence platforms.

  • Designing scalable AI pipelines integrating enterprise databases with Retrieval-Augmented Generation (RAG)
  • Developing intelligent systems for real-time insight, predictive, and prescriptive analytics
  • Supporting deployment and optimization of GPU-based compute infrastructure for large-scale AI workloads
  • Collaborating with multidisciplinary teams across national projects under UGC
Visit Research Lab
January 2023 – December 2025
Research Assistant
Cognitive Agents & Interaction Lab (CAIL), University of Dhaka

Conducted research in AI and Machine Learning with a focus on NLP, OCR, and low-resource language technologies.

  • Developed deep learning-based OCR systems for Bengali handwritten text recognition
  • Trained and optimized models on multi-GPU servers using PyTorch
  • Implemented mixed-precision training, gradient checkpointing, and distributed pipelines
  • Co-authored research published at EMNLP 2025
  • Mentored undergraduate students in AI research and machine learning deployment
Visit Research Lab
July 2023 – Present
Software Engineer (Part-time)
AlterYouth

Developing backend services and scalable data pipelines using Django, PostgreSQL, Celery, and Redis. Contributing to an Android-based education platform used by teachers across rural Bangladesh.

Visit
December 2019 – 2022
Mathematics Instructor (Part-time)
UDVASH Academic Coaching

Taught advanced mathematics for university admission preparation. Mentored students in analytical problem-solving and mathematical reasoning.

Workshops & Outreach

October 18–19, 2024
Hands-On Deep Learning & Open-Source Large Language Model
Trainer  ·  Cognitive Agents & Interaction Lab, CSEDU

Department of Computer Science and Engineering, University of Dhaka

Delivered hands-on training sessions on deep learning fundamentals and open-source large language models as part of a 2-day workshop organized by the Cognitive Agents & Interaction Lab, CSEDU.

February 2025
Mastering Machine Learning Fundamentals: A Practical Workshop
Trainer  ·  IEEE NSU

North South University

Conducted a 2-day practical workshop on machine learning fundamentals at North South University, invited by IEEE NSU. Covered foundational ML concepts, model training workflows, and real-world deployment through hands-on exercises.

May 26, 2025
BRAC Presents 1st S.N. Bose National Science Festival – 2025
Problem Setter & Judge — IT Hackathon

University of Dhaka

Served as problem setter and judge for the IT Hackathon track focused on AI-powered applications. The creativity each team brought was incredible — sparking vital conversations about building responsibly with AI, including awareness of its potential to generate false information.

Education

July 2025 – Present
Master of Science in Computer Science & Engineering
University of Dhaka, Bangladesh

Focus: Advanced topics in Artificial Intelligence and Machine Learning
Research: Deep Learning architectures, Transformer models, AI applications

2020 – 2025
Bachelor of Science in Computer Science & Engineering
University of Dhaka, Bangladesh

Thesis: Bangla Abstractive Summarizer with Attention-based Learning Technique for Long Articles
Relevant Coursework: Advanced Algorithms, Data Science, Artificial Intelligence, Machine Learning, Database Systems, Computer Networks, Discrete Mathematics, Linear Algebra

2017 – 2019
Higher Secondary Certificate (Science)
Government Science College, Dhaka

GPA: 5.00/5.00 (Perfect Score) — Strong foundation in Mathematics, Physics, Chemistry, and Biology

Honors & Recognition

Ministry of ICT Bangladesh
Research Fellowship 2025–26
Ministry of ICT, People's Republic of Bangladesh

Awarded national research fellowship by the ICT Division of Bangladesh for contributions to ICT research and innovation

2nd Runners-Up
SUST DL ENIGMA 1.0, 2024

Deep Learning competition recognizing excellence in machine learning and AI research

National Finalist (Top 11)
Code Samurai Hackathon, 2022 & 2024

Teams: DU_TripleHash, DU_Fireflies | Advanced to finals of Bangladesh's premier hackathon, 3rd in Phase-2

Top 5 Finalist
Therap Javafest, 2023

Team: DU_StormSurge | National Java programming and software development competition

National Winner (11th)
Bangladesh Science Olympiad, 2019

Demonstrated excellence in scientific problem-solving and analytical thinking at national level

Featured Research Projects

CognifyQ – AI-Powered Educational Assessment Platform
Visit
Team Lead | 2023 – Present

Comprehensive AI-driven platform that automates question generation and script evaluation using Large Language Models. Employs semantic-aware grading to provide immediate, unbiased feedback, reducing teacher workload while enabling consistent, meaningful assessment that promotes self-learning.

Key Innovations: Semantic evaluation engine, automated question bank generation, handwritten answer processing, curriculum-aligned assessment, multi-format input support (text, images, PDFs)

Python PyTorch Transformers vLLM LLMs OCR
Bengali Abstractive Summarizer & Translator
Visit
Undergraduate Thesis | 2023–2024

Developed attention-based neural network model for Bengali text summarization, addressing challenges in low-resource language processing with novel tokenization and attention mechanisms.

NLP PyTorch Attention Mechanism Bengali NLP
SmartStock – AI Investment Platform
Visit
Team Lead | 2022

Machine learning platform for stock market analysis and prediction using LSTM and Transformer models for short-term price prediction with comprehensive portfolio optimization features.

Python TensorFlow LSTM Spring Boot ReactJS
CHESS-AI – Intelligent Game Engine
Visit
Team Leader | 2021

Advanced chess engine implementing minimax algorithm with alpha-beta pruning and position evaluation functions. Capable of playing at 1400+ ELO with multiple difficulty settings and move analysis.

C++ SDL2 Algorithms Game AI
Lucent – Transparent NGO Payment System
Frontend Developer | 2022

Blockchain-inspired payment platform ensuring transaction transparency for NGOs. Features multi-platform support, secure payment integration, and real-time transaction tracking to increase donor confidence and organizational accountability.

VueJS Spring Boot Android Payment Gateway
View All Projects on GitHub

Academic Service

January 2024 – January 2025
General Secretary
CSEDU Students' Club, University of Dhaka
  • Led organization of academic conferences, workshops, and technical seminars for 300+ students
  • Initiated and organized debating competitions from 2022 to 2024
  • Organized the first-ever CTF contest in the Department of Computer Science and Engineering, University of Dhaka
  • Organized guest lectures featuring prominent researchers and industry professionals
December 2021 – February 2024
Secretary
CSEDU Students' Club, University of Dhaka

Maintained official records, coordinated inter-departmental activities, organized study groups, and technical skill development.

November 2020 – December 2021
Executive Member
CSEDU Students' Club, University of Dhaka

Contributed to event organization, student welfare initiatives, and department-wide activities supporting academic and extracurricular excellence.

Technical Skills

AI/ML Technologies

PyTorch TensorFlow Transformers OpenCV NLTK Scikit-learn Pandas NumPy

Programming Languages

Python C++ Java JavaScript SQL C

Web & Mobile Development

Django Spring Boot ReactJS VueJS Android RESTful APIs

Tools & Platforms

Git Docker Linux PostgreSQL Firebase Celery